The Dorset All Age Community Eating disorders service has an exciting opportunity for a Specialist Practitioner in Eating Disorders. You will have the option of being based at Trinity Court in Dorchester or our new base Spring Court on the Kings Park Hospital site.

Experience of delivering NICE concordant eating disorders treatment is advantageous, however we also invite your expression of interest if you have transferable skills gained from working in other areas of mental health (adults and/or children) and would embrace the opportunity to develop the eating disorder specific competencies required. We will support and facilitate your development, tailored to your learning needs and experience.

The team will provide evidence-based interventions to people with
an ED, their families/carers.

The principal role is in partnership with people with an ED, families
and carers to assess, plan and implement evidence-based
interventions and care to promote recovery from eating disorders.
The post holder will hold their own caseload and work closely with
all other members of the multi-disciplinary team.

A key secondary role is in liaison and joint working with other
professionals, including general practice, CAMHS, adult mental
health, LEA/schools and universities, to support integrated treatment
and to widen awareness of the complexities involved in the
management and treatment of Eating Disorders.

The post is offered as a 20-month secondment or fixed term contract. Full or Part-time (Monday to Friday 09:00 - 17:00). There is also an option of a permanent contract, with 20 months in the eating disorder service, followed by redeployment within the Trust should the demand for eating disorder services reduce
